This case arises out of a two-car accident in Torrington on September 27, 1979, in which the plaintiff, Roger Peck, Jr., a passenger, was injured. In the ensuing negligence action instituted in 1981, Peck sued both drivers, Paul Jacquemin and Ira J. Roy.
